Overview

We are an urban-based, largely volunteer-run group supported by Cork Healthy Cities. Our work is concerned with reconnecting communities with nature, supporting biodiversity initiatives, and creating and protecting habitats for nature. We plant trees, maintain meadows and connect and support many of the food-growing community gardens across the city. We run and host courses on topics such as seed saving and dye gardens, and have a strong focus on "the work that reconnects" and the fundamentals of eco-arts and eco-literacy.
